Pet's info: Dog | Chihuahua | Male | neutered | 10 lbs
Will it harm my Chihuahua if I give him ear mite drops if he doesn't have them?

If you gave the medication according to label instructions, and used the correct size for your dog, then no. It won't harm him to have given the medicine even if he didn't have era mites. Thank you for asking Petco Pet Education Center, formerly Petcoach!

More information on what ear mite drops you are planning to use can help us to better answer your question, so if you can provide us with the brand name/active ingredient or a photo of the label we can better answer your question. In most cases of dogs with itchy ears we actually have a problem with an overgrowth of bacteria or yeast in the ears. For this reason I would suggest a vet exam to check and see if mites are the cause of Chewy's ear issues as you wouldn't want to delay getting him the appropriate medication by treating for the wrong issue.
